Ajay Bruno is a conservative political consultant, freelance journalist, and podcast host.

Career[edit]

Bruno first became known in the political community while serving as State Director for the Michele Bachmann 2012 Presidential campaign. He later attempted to run for Congress in the Republican primary against disgraced Congressman Mark Sanford[1], citing the need for a challenger.[2]

He has written numerous pieces with a generally solidly conservative viewpoint for publications such as The Hill, Bold, The National Pulse, and Newscult.[3]

Since the beginning of 2018, Bruno has been regularly releasing podcasts, with a theme of the week interview format. Past guests have included prominent political figures such as Governor George Allen, scientists such as astronomer Dr. Seth Shostak[4] and singer/actor James Darren.[5]

He also runs the 'Reagan Worldwide' Twitter account, which serves to both promote his podcast, as well as advocate conservative principles both in the US, and around the world.[6]
